TUMBARUMBA Overview

Tumbarumba is located in Regional NSW. According to ABS 2021 Census, the population is 1,915 with a density of 8 people/km².

Property: According to NSW Rent and Sales Report (Nov 2025), house median $440,000, below Sydney average.

Education: No high schools in this suburb.

Safety: According to NSW BOCSAR 2025 data, crime rate is 5379 per 100,000, 0.81x the NSW average, a safe area.

Demographics: Australian comprises 42.98%, the largest ethnic group, followed by English (40.10%) and Scottish (11.96%).

Transport: No train station coverage.
